I accidentally disliked a profile I was interested in. Can I get it back?
Yes, but it depends on whether you've already interacted with that person.
When you dislike or block a profile, it is removed from your personalized search results and will no longer appear while you're logged into your account.
Here are a couple of ways to find them again:
Option 1: You've already interacted
If the person previously:
- sent you a message,
- liked your profile, or
- matched with you,
you can still access their profile through the link found in your Message, Likes, or Matches email notifications. From there, simply visit their profile and send a message to start (or restart) the conversation.
Option 2: You haven't interacted yet
If you haven't exchanged any likes or messages:
- Log out of your Diggz account (or open Diggz in an Incognito/Private browser window).
- Navigate to the city where the profile was listed using the Take a Tour menu or the city links on the Diggz homepage.
- Browse the roommate search and use filters (age, budget, lifestyle, etc.) to narrow the results until you find the profile.
- Copy or bookmark the profile URL.
- Log back into your Diggz account and paste the URL into your browser. You'll be able to visit the profile and send an Intro Message if you're interested.
Tip: If you're unsure about someone, consider leaving them in your search results rather than disliking them. You can always come back to review their profile later.
